The ^24 Mg( α ,p) ^27 Al reaction measurement using solenoid spectrometer for nuclear astrophysics (SSNAP)

The ^24 Mg( α ,p) ^27 Al reaction was measured using the solenoid spectrometer for nuclear astrophysics at the University of the Notre Dame to study the astrophysical ^24 Mg( α ,p) ^27 Al reaction rate. Alpha beams from the 10-MV FN tandem accelerator impinged on ^24 Mg solid targets which were made using the vacuum evaporation method on ^12 C foils. A total of 43 beam energies were used. Recoiling protons from the ^24 Mg( α ,p) ^27 Al reaction were detected using a double-sided position sensitive silicon detector array mounted on the solenoid. Energies, times of flight, and flight distances of particles were measured for particle identification. Protons associated with a wide range of excitation energies E_x = 12.42–14.44 MeV in ^28 Si were identified.
